About CAMP Systems:
At CAMP Systems, we are the trusted leader in aircraft compliance and health management, proudly serving the global business aviation industry. With over 20,000 aircraft and 33,000 engines supported on our cutting-edge platforms, and partnerships with more than 1,300 maintenance facilities and parts suppliers worldwide, we’re shaping the future of aviation technology. Since our founding in 1968, we’ve grown to a dynamic team of 1,600+ employees across 14 locations globally—all united by a passion for innovation and excellence.

What You Will Experience In This Role:
The Aircraft Maintenance Program Analyst will have a critical role in the management and performance of one of CAMP’s core services offerings. The Aircraft Maintenance Program Analyst will be responsible for implementing approved customized maintenance programs and program revisions for operators of large business jet aircraft. In addition, the Aircraft Maintenance Program Analyst will provide analyst level support to their customers during implementation and preparation of the maintenance program for Operations Analyst support. The Aircraft Maintenance Program Analyst works with the Aircraft Maintenance Program Team to ensure a consistent and clear customer service plan for CAMP customers who require custom aircraft maintenance program services.
